Output 94bf39503ebe89f3990c3783d953be331cc2b84a1f68598bc9c442dc353ea3b3:6

value
10401682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24af479af1e497a73fc65ec52d9f7bcda0b87d91 OP_EQUAL
address
MBF8Xz1RpLSrmmJHRxDj1DSsuNM3d56WNq
transaction
94bf39503ebe89f3990c3783d953be331cc2b84a1f68598bc9c442dc353ea3b3
spent
true